PHP使用mysql与mysqli连接Mysql数据库用法示例

 更新时间:2016年07月07日 10:07:17   作者:HTL  
这篇文章主要介绍了PHP使用mysql与mysqli连接Mysql数据库的方法,结合实例形式分析了mysql与mysqli操作数据库的连接、查询、断开的相关实现技巧,需要的朋友可以参考下

本文实例讲述了PHP使用mysql与mysqli连接Mysql数据库的方法。分享给大家供大家参考,具体如下:

代码很简单直接上了

<?php
  /**
  * @Author:   HTL
  * @Description: Description
  */
  // 降低PHP默认的错误级别
  // 只显示除禁用以外的所有错误
  // 解决因为PHP5.3+版本太高而导致在使用mysql_connect时出现的弃用警告“Deprecated: mysql_connect(): The mysql extension is deprecated and will be removed in the future: use mysqli or PDO instead”
  error_reporting(E_ALL ^ E_DEPRECATED);
  $db_host="localhost";
  $db_user="root";
  $db_passwd="";
  $db_name="mysql";
  echo("<BR>---------------------------mysql_connect------------------------<BR><BR>");
  $query = "SELECT SESSION_USER(), CURRENT_USER(),now();";
  $conn = mysql_connect($db_host, $db_user,$db_passwd);
  if (!$conn)
  {
   die('Could not connect: ' . mysql_error());
  }
  mysql_select_db($db_name, $conn);
  $result = mysql_query($query);
  while($row = mysql_fetch_array($result)){
   var_dump($row);
  }
  mysql_close($conn);
  echo("<BR>---------------------------mysqli_connect------------------------<BR><BR>");
  $conn = mysqli_connect($db_host, $db_user, $db_passwd,$db_name) ;
  if (!$conn)
  {
   die('Could not connect: ' . mysqli_error());
  }
  //execute the query.
  $result = mysqli_query($conn, $query);
  //display information:
  while($row = mysqli_fetch_array($result)) {
    var_dump($row);
  }
  mysqli_close($conn);
  exit();
?>

有图有真相

更多关于PHP相关内容感兴趣的读者可查看本站专题:《php+mysqli数据库程序设计技巧总结》、《PHP基于pdo操作数据库技巧总结》、《PHP运算与运算符用法总结》、《PHP网络编程技巧总结》、《php面向对象程序设计入门教程》、《php字符串(string)用法总结》、《php+mysql数据库操作入门教程》及《php常见数据库操作技巧汇总

希望本文所述对大家PHP程序设计有所帮助。

相关文章

  • PHP入门教程之会话控制技巧(cookie与session)

    PHP入门教程之会话控制技巧(cookie与session)

    这篇文章主要介绍了PHP入门教程之会话控制技巧,结合实例形式分析了cookie与session的具体使用方法与相关注意事项,需要的朋友可以参考下
    2016-09-09
  • PHP中substr()与explode()函数用法分析

    PHP中substr()与explode()函数用法分析

    这篇文章主要介绍了PHP中substr()与explode()函数用法分析,以实例的形式较为详细的讲述了substr()与explode()函数处理字符串的技巧,是字符串操作中使用频率比较高的函数,具有一定的实用价值,需要的朋友可以参考下
    2014-11-11
  • php使用str_replace实现输入框回车替换br的方法

    php使用str_replace实现输入框回车替换br的方法

    这篇文章主要介绍了php使用str_replace实现输入框回车替换br的方法,可实现使用\\n替换成br的方法,需要的朋友可以参考下
    2014-11-11
  • PHP-FPM实现性能优化

    PHP-FPM实现性能优化

    本文给大家介绍的是通过php-fpm实现性能优化的配置方法以及注意事项,有需要的小伙伴可以参考下
    2016-03-03
  • php中日期类型转换实例讲解

    php中日期类型转换实例讲解

    在本篇文章里小编给大家整理了一篇关于php中日期类型转换实例讲解内容,有兴趣的朋友们可以学习参考下。
    2021-09-09
  • PHP实现支持SSL连接的SMTP邮件发送类

    PHP实现支持SSL连接的SMTP邮件发送类

    这篇文章主要介绍了PHP实现支持SSL连接的SMTP邮件发送类,实例分析了php实现smtp邮件发送类的原理与技巧,以及支持SSL连接的方法,需要的朋友可以参考下
    2015-03-03
  • PHP使用mongoclient简单操作mongodb数据库示例

    PHP使用mongoclient简单操作mongodb数据库示例

    这篇文章主要介绍了PHP使用mongoclient简单操作mongodb数据库,结合实例形式分析了php使用mongoclient针对MongoDB数据库的连接、增删改查及相关函数使用技巧,需要的朋友可以参考下
    2019-02-02
  • PHP函数http_build_query使用详解

    PHP函数http_build_query使用详解

    这篇文章主要介绍了PHP函数http_build_query使用详解,分别对传入一维关联数组、一维索引数组、二维数组、传入对象等给出示例,需要的朋友可以参考下
    2014-08-08
  • php str_getcsv把字符串解析为数组的实现方法

    php str_getcsv把字符串解析为数组的实现方法

    下面小编就为大家带来一篇php str_getcsv把字符串解析为数组的实现方法。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2017-04-04
  • PHP完全二叉树定义与实现方法示例

    PHP完全二叉树定义与实现方法示例

    这篇文章主要介绍了PHP完全二叉树定义与实现方法,简单描述了完全二叉树的概念并结合实例形式给出了完全二叉树的定义、节点查找、添加、设置、打印等相关操作技巧,需要的朋友可以参考下
    2017-10-10

最新评论